Interdisciplinary Conference on Tobacco Regulation and E-cigarette Control
Brazil to hold its first interdisciplinary conference, the "SBGMD," on November 25 in Guarujá to discuss tobacco regulation and e-cigarette impact.

Brazil will hold its first interdisciplinary conference on November 25th, Saturday, called the "SBGMD". The conference will take place in Guarujá and will address all aspects of tobacco use regulation, including issues concerning the suboptimal health population and smoking cessation efforts.

 

Doctors and scientists will discuss at the conference the impact of e-cigarette use on health and methods of controlling this practice.

Belgium Approves Vape Flavor Ban, Allowing Only Tobacco-Flavored and Unflavored Products From September 2028
Belgium Approves Vape Flavor Ban, Allowing Only Tobacco-Flavored and Unflavored Products From September 2028
Belgium’s federal government on Thursday approved a ban on flavored vapes, allowing only tobacco-flavored and unflavored e-cigarettes on the market from September 2028. Health Minister Frank Vandenbroucke said the measure is aimed at protecting the health of children and young people and preventing a new generation from becoming dependent on tobacco.

KT&G Launches Two New lil AIBLE Dedicated Sticks as Aim Portfolio Expands to 13
KT&G Launches Two New lil AIBLE Dedicated Sticks as Aim Portfolio Expands to 13
KT&G said on April 20 that it has launched two new “AIIM” sticks for its lil AIBLE heated tobacco device at convenience stores nationwide in South Korea. The new products are “AIIM CHANGE UP” and “AIIM COOL SHOT.” The company said the products were developed based on the existing lil SOLID dedicated sticks “Fiit Change Up” and “Fiit Cool Shot.” With the launch, the Aim lineup for lil AIBLE has expanded to 13 products.
